Police plead for tips as three children aged 8 to 14 are killed in Stockton birthday party shooting
STOCKTON, CALIFORNIA: California Police appealed to the public for tips, mobile phone clips, witness accounts, and other proof as the suspects in the mass shooting at a child’s birthday party in Stockton, California, remain at large. The shooting led to the deaths of three children, aged eight to 14, and an adult.
In a press conference on Sunday, November 30, San Joaquin County Sheriff Patrick Withrow told the press that authorities believed there were multiple shooters. He also mentioned that while the shooting began indoors, it went on outdoors.
Sheriff urges anyone with information to contact his office
Sheriff Patrick Withrow said the deceased were aged eight, nine, 14, and 21. According to him, eleven people were wounded, with at least one in critical condition. No one was in custody by Sunday and the sheriff urged anyone with information to contact his office.
He said during a media briefing, "This is a time for our community to show that we will not put up with this type of behaviour, when people will just walk in and kill children."

"And so if you know anything about this, you have to come forward and tell us what you know. If not, you just become complacent and think this is acceptable behaviour," Withrow added.
The sheriff’s spokesperson Heather Brent earlier said that investigators believed it was a "targeted incident." Officials did not explain why authorities thought it was intentional or who might have been targeted.
On Sunday, faith leaders held a vigil to honor the deceased and pray for the wounded.
Investigators welcome any information regarding the shooting
The mass shooting took place just before 6 pm on Saturday, inside the banquet hall, which shares a parking lot with other businesses in the city.
Brent told reporters, "This was a birthday party for a young child, and the fact that this happened is absolutely heartbreaking," adding that investigators would welcome any information, "even rumors."
Meanwhile, District Attorney Ron Freitas warned the shooter to "turn yourself in immediately."
The Stockton Police Department arrested five people hours after the shooting, including a juvenile, on weapons and gang-related charges. However, there was no indication that the arrests were connected to the killings at the banquet hall, the sheriff said.
Stockton Mayor Christina Fugazi informed reporters that the eight-year-old victim attended a local school and had a parent who worked for the Stockton Unified School District.
The mayor added, "They should be writing their Christmas lists right now. Their parents should be out shopping for them for Christmas. And to think that their lives are over. I can’t even begin to imagine what these families are going through. Breaks my heart."
